Experience Description


11 July 2002, we decided to make a tour on the motorbike.


When returning home I closed my eyes for a moment because of the brightness of the Sun, we were driving about 50 kilometers per hour, suddenly my husband started cursing, the motorbike accelerated enormously and I did not have the time to open my eyes. It had happened in a flash, a bang, a few somersaults and there we were lying. I suddenly felt very peaceful and happy and felt I wanted to leave my body when suddenly someone or something told me, "Don't go yet, it is not your time, your children still need you." I felt someone take my hand and saw or knew that it was a woman all dressed in white and she made me feel very calm.


The I opened my eyes, I was lying in the grass and looked towards the Sun that warmed my face, next to me there was a grasshopper that looked right at me, and I wanted to shout for joy, I felt one with everything, all is beauty, then I felt a needle in my hand and got very angry I had to stand up and take off my helmet, I had to go home to my kids then I was pressed on the ground and got a terrible pain in my leg and was totally conscious again.


In the mean time police and ambulance had arrived and from their talk I understood that it was impossible we had survived this, also the policeman said,: "Gee, those two were very lucky" because at the same time of our accident someone died in a similar way also with a truck and a motorbike.


I did not realize very well what had happened because I could not see my wounded leg, and thought I had just sprawled my ankle, when I heard the medics talk about Gent ( a mayor city in Belgium, translator note) and amputation.


I first thought they were talking about my husband. Well, then we went into the ambulance, photos were taken, (a true nightmare) operation, intensive care, and blood.


When later I inquired with my doctor what all the numbers meant (I had remembered them) he told me that I had lost half of my blood, and had to be glad that I was still alive. How it is possible that I remained conscious apart from the NDE I do not know, even the doctors do not understand and I ask myself no questions about this any longer.


When the other day I was allowed to move and saw my husband I got a laughing fit, but really a very strong one, I lasted for two hours, and the nurses only worsened it when they asked what was wrong, because I didn't know , and still don't know.
